Understanding Silver Bars
Silver bars, also known as silver ingots or silver bullion bars, are standardized units of refined silver. Unlike silver rounds, which are typically minted in one-ounce sizes, silver bars come in a wider range of weights, from fractional ounces to large kilobar (approximately 32.15 troy ounces) and even 100-ounce or 1000-ounce bars. These bars are usually stamped with the refiner’s or mint’s hallmark, purity (commonly .999 or .9999 fine silver), weight, and a unique serial number for larger bars, which aids in tracking and authenticity verification. The primary appeal of silver bars, especially in bulk, lies in their straightforward valuation based on silver content and their lower premiums over the spot price of silver compared to smaller units.
Types of Silver Bars
Silver bars can be broadly categorized into two main types: Cast bars and Minted bars. Cast bars are produced by pouring molten silver into bar-shaped molds and allowing it to cool. They often have a more rustic, matte finish and may display slight imperfections, but they generally command lower premiums due to the simpler manufacturing process. Minted bars, on the other hand, are struck from silver blanks, similar to how coins or rounds are made. They typically feature sharper details, a more polished appearance, and sometimes intricate designs, but may carry a slightly higher premium. For buyers seeking bulk silver bars for sale, understanding these distinctions helps in choosing based on priority—cost versus aesthetic.
Purity and Weight Standards
The purity and weight of silver bars are the most critical specifications. Reputable refiners produce bars with a minimum purity of .999 fine silver, meaning 99.9% pure silver. Higher purities, such as .9999 fine silver, are also available from some mints. Weights are measured in troy ounces (1 troy ounce ≈ 31.1 grams). When purchasing bulk silver bars for sale, always verify these details. The weight and purity directly determine the bar’s intrinsic value. Comparing Prices and Premiums
The price of silver bars is determined by the current spot price of silver plus a premium. This premium covers the costs of refining, manufacturing, distribution, and the supplier’s profit. When buying in bulk, the premium per ounce typically decreases significantly. For example, a 1000-ounce bar will almost always have a lower premium than a single one-ounce round. To find the bulk silver bars for sale at the best value, compare the per-ounce premium across different suppliers for the specific weight and type of bar you need. Authenticity and Assay Certification
The risk of counterfeit precious metals is a significant concern, especially with larger purchases. Always buy silver bars that come with assay certification from a reputable assayer or mint. This certification guarantees the bar’s purity and weight. Larger bars often bear serial numbers that can be traced back to the mint, providing an additional layer of security. Market Trends and Price Volatility
The price of silver is subject to market fluctuations influenced by global economic conditions, industrial demand, monetary policies, and geopolitical events. While silver is often seen as a hedge against inflation, its price can be volatile in the short term. Understanding these market dynamics is crucial for timing purchases and assessing the overall investment strategy. For industrial consumers, managing this volatility might involve hedging strategies or securing long-term supply contracts. The Role of Premiums
The price of a silver bar is the sum of the current spot price of silver and the dealer’s premium. Premiums are influenced by factors such as the bar’s weight, mint, design, and the quantity purchased. Larger bars (e.g., 100 oz, 1000 oz) have significantly lower premiums per ounce compared to smaller bars or rounds. For instance, a 1000 oz bar might have a premium of $0.20-$0.50 per ounce, whereas a 1 oz round could have a premium of $2-$4 per ounce. Common Pitfalls When Buying Bulk Silver
Purchasing large quantities of silver requires extra diligence to avoid common mistakes that can erode value or compromise security.
- Mistake 1: Overlooking Authenticity Verification. The risk of counterfeits increases with the value of the transaction. Always insist on assay-certified bars from recognized refiners and verify serial numbers where applicable.
- Mistake 2: Underestimating Shipping and Insurance Costs. Secure transport for high-value commodities is expensive. Failing to budget adequately for fully insured shipping can leave you exposed to significant loss.
- Mistake 3: Choosing Unreliable Suppliers. Dealing with unknown or poorly reviewed vendors for bulk purchases can lead to fraud, delays, or receiving substandard products. Thorough due diligence is critical.
- Mistake 4: Neglecting Storage and Security. Storing large quantities of silver requires robust security measures. Inadequate storage can make your assets vulnerable to theft.
- Mistake 5: Ignoring Regulatory and Tax Implications. Failing to understand import duties, taxes, and compliance requirements in China can lead to unexpected costs and legal issues.
